As the acceptance review of the National Important Mineral Resources Potential Evaluation Programended, the research team of the National Important Mineral Resources and Regional Mineralization Regularity Program undertaken by the Institute of Mineral Resources, CAGS published two monographs recently through Geological Publishing House: Research on TypicalMesozoic Molybdenum Deposits in East China and National Diagenesis-Mineralization Chronology. The research team of the National Crisis Mine Reserved Resources Program published Research on Pan-Beibu Gulf Guangxi-Hainan Typical Cu-Sn-Pb-Zn-Au Deposits.

Research on Typical Mesozoic Molybdenum Deposits in East China (Huang Fan et al.)analyzes deposits such asthe Yili Mo deposit in the DaHinggan mineralization province,Shapinggou Mo deposit in the Qinling-Dabie mineralization province, Yuanlingzhai Mo deposit in the South China mineralization province, and summarizes mineralization regularities, providing theoretical reference for geological exploration and potential evaluation.National Diagenesis-Mineralization Chronology (Wang Denghong et al.) preliminarily discusses diagenesis-mineralization chronology based on 11886 pieces of diagenesis-mineralization age data (serving as a reference book)and illustrates its 5 roles in potential evaluation: measuring age of typical deposits and establishing mineralization models; revealing geotectonic setting and tracing mineralization history; clarifying stages of mineralization evolution and building metallogenic lineage; summarizing regional mineralization regularities and determining prospecting directions; finding regional mineralization factors and guiding prospecting forecast.

Pan-Beibu Gulf Guangxi-Hainan Typical Cu-Sn-Pb-Zn-Au Deposits covers the research achievements of the Gaolong Au deposit, Debao Cu deposit, Cu-Sn polymetallic deposit,Longtoushan Au deposit,Fuzichong Pb-Zn deposit, and Shilu Fe deposit,touching upon mining area geology,orebody geology,mineralization zoning,ore petrology,mineralogy, wall rock alteration, mineralization stage, mineralization age, mineralization fluid,isotope geochemistry,ore field structure,mineralization specificity, regional structure and evolution, mineralization mechanism and pattern, mineralization regularity,and mineralization forecast, etc.

In addition, Mineral Deposits, Geochemistry, and Mineralization Regularity of Dazhuyuan Bauxite Deposit in Guizhou (Li Peigang, Wang Denghong et al.)jointly written by the Institute of Mineral Resources and the Guizhou No. 106 Geological Team was published by Science Press. This book presents the latest achievements of the package exploration in the Wuzhengdao area, Guizhou Province, i.e., achievements of the research on potential evaluation of typical deposits,and shows necessity to integrate scientific research with production.
